    Abstract: Various embodiments of primary synchronization signal detection are provided. In one aspect, a method receives one or more signals at one or more antennas of a receiver. The method processes the one or more received signals by decimation filtering the one or more received signals to provide one or more decimated signals, each of the one or more decimated signals having a predetermined symbol size, and enumerating correlation of the one or more decimated signals with a plurality of reference signals to provide correlation results. The method then detects a primary synchronization signal (PSS) based on the correlation results.

    Abstract: Various embodiments of a mechanism of dynamic allocation of bandplan are provided. In one aspect, a communication device utilizes a bandplan during initialization in a digital communication system. The communication device modifies the bandplan after one or more channel estimations to optimize data rates of communications in a downstream direction and an upstream direction.

    Abstract: The present disclosure outlines mechanisms, systems, methods, techniques and devices that reposition a RMC symbol in a TDD frame. In one aspect, a method queues data transmission units (DTUs) for transmission in a TDD OFDM communication system, with each of the DTUs occupying a single symbol partially or fully, or multiple symbols, of a series of symbols in a TDD frame. The method also forms a management symbol for transmission in a kth symbol position of the series of symbol positions, k>1. The method further transmits the symbols sequentially in the TDD frame.

    Abstract: Various embodiments of a transmit diversity decoding techniques are provided. In one aspect, a method receives a first input that includes signals transmitted by M transmit antennas on C channels and received by N receive antennas, where M, N and C is each a positive integer greater than 1. The method also receives a second input that includes estimates of channel matrix elements. The method further generates an output that includes at least an estimate of a transmit signal transmitted by one of the M transmit antennas on one of the C channels based at least in part on the first and the second inputs.

    Abstract: Described herein are a technique, method, device and system related to reducing memory requirements and complexity in receivers. According to the present disclosure, the capability to request precoded ACE symbols is added to receivers in a mode under the g.hn MIMO standards that uses precoding to enhance the capacity of links. Using precoded ACE symbols, memory requirements for the receiver can be reduced as it is not necessary for the receiver to save the precoder coefficients. Additionally, the frequency of updates required for the precoding coefficients can be reduced by adapting the MIMO decoder using the precoded ACE symbols as reference symbols.

    Abstract: In the present disclosure, several techniques are proposed to estimate the worst-case crosstalk noise and use it for bit-loading and SRA calculations so that fluctuating crosstalk when PET mode is enabled does not lead to system instability. One of the proposed techniques involves strategically placing some marker tones in the transmitters of the affecting lines. The noise floor may be inferred by interpolating the noise observed on these marker tones (tones that are always-on) and applying to the entire frequency band on the victim line. Another proposed technique involves periodically transmitting a set of marker symbols (fully loaded OFDM symbols), so that a victim channel can estimate the SNRs in a worst case crosstalk scenario.

    Abstract: Various embodiments of a power saving scheme in data communication are provided. In one aspect, a method transmits a plurality of symbols each of which containing an overhead portion and at least a portion of a respective data transmission unit (DTU). In particular, the method transmits the overhead portion of a first symbol of the plurality of symbols and the at least a portion of a respective DTU of the first symbol when the at least a portion of the respective DTU of the first symbol contains payload data. The method transmits the overhead portion of a second symbol of the plurality of symbols without transmitting the at least a portion of a respective DTU of the second symbol when the at least a portion of the respective DTU of the second symbol contains no payload data.
